Victoria Falls, Zambia & Zimbabwe


Victoria Falls is one of the natural wonders of southern Africa. One of the largest waterfalls in the world (twice as high as Niagara Falls) it sits along the Zambezi River, snaking the border between Zambia and Zimbabwe. It is open to tourists from both sides of the border and has drawn millions of visitors from around the world.

“… scenes so lovely must have been gazed upon by angels in their flight,” expressed Dr. David Livingstone on his first sighting in 1855. He was the first European to see the Falls – one of the 7 natural wonders of the world. Unlike in Livingstone’s time, today’s travel options allow you to gaze upon the Falls like angels in flight.

Over Victoria Falls, Zambia / Zimbabwe


Enjoy more videos like this on our YouTube Channel.

Have you ever taken a helicopter over a favorite travel destination?  Perhaps a hot air balloon?  Share your stories and photos in Comments below!



You May Also Like